Key Considerations for Dumpster Rental Length
Several factors determine how long you can keep a rented dumpster. The scale and type of project largely dictate the rental length. Minor household projects usually take less time, but larger renovations require more extended dumpster access. Material type matters, particularly if you’re disposing of bulky or heavy items that slow down the process.
How you schedule delivery and pickup can impact how long you can hold the dumpster. High-demand periods, such as construction season, can limit dumpster availability. Planning your rental in advance ensures you get the dumpster when needed and reduces the chance of delays. What Happens When the Rental Period Ends
Once your agreed-upon rental period ends, the dumpster is scheduled for pickup. It’s important to ensure that the dumpster is ready for removal before that date. This means all waste should be properly loaded, and the area around the dumpster should be clear of obstacles. Being ready on time enables seamless pickup and avoids project disruptions.
If the dumpster is not ready for pickup on the scheduled date, contacting the rental provider is essential. They can offer guidance or reschedule the collection if necessary. Staying in touch ensures smooth pickup and avoids project complications. A well-coordinated pickup helps maintain safety, ef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
